Fraud is wrongful or criminal deception intended to result in financial or personal gain. It is one of the challenges to organisations that Information Security tries to prevent.

For example, showing a screen on a website or mobile app that looks like a genuine login screen, could be used by an attacker to capture user credentials for use in fraudulent transactions.
